Research On The Teaching Design Of Number Sequences In Senior High School Based On Deeper Learning Cycle

In the past few decades of educational reform,the hard work of educators has brought about significant changes in teaching concepts and methods in basic education.However,in today’s digital information age,we must continue to promote the modernization of education by applying new concepts and technologies from artificial intelligence to education and teaching.The concept of deep learning,derived from research on artificial neural networks,coincides with the idea of in-depth learning that has been permeating modern educational reform,making it a valuable addition to the field of education.While the theory of deep learning has matured,teachers often feel powerless in designing teaching methods that enable students to achieve deep learning in practical classroom settings.Theoretical concepts have not been closely linked to practical teaching strategies.To address this issue,this study analyzes relevant literature on deep learning theory and combines it with the Deep Learning Cycle to create a more comprehensive teaching design process that better serves teachers in conducting deep learning activities.Specifically,this research focuses on teaching design in the high school sequence chapter based on DELC.The study first analyzes the seven steps that define DELC,then investigates students’ current state of deep learning at each stage of the sequence chapter through a survey questionnaire.The main questions of the questionnaire revolve around the four stages of DELC: front-end analysis,preparation stage,implementation stage,and evaluation and feedback stage.Finally,the data results are analyzed to summarize the factors influencing deep learning and corresponding teaching design strategies.Before designing a deep learning teaching case based on DELC for the high school sequence chapter,this study also designs a DELC unit teaching for the entire sequence chapter to help teachers grasp the overall teaching design of the deep learning path,rather than being limited to specific content.Guided by the DELC unit teaching design,the study designs and implements teaching for "the sum of the first n terms of an arithmetic sequence" in the classroom,better identifying student problems at each stage of DELC and modifying teaching design accordingly.The study summarizes corresponding teaching design strategies for each stage of DELC: integrating unit teaching,identifying key points;creating a positive learning culture,activating prior knowledge;deep and precise processing,promoting knowledge transfer and application;establishing an evaluation system,improving teaching design guidance.Based on theoretical research and practical testing,this study proposes a specific process and steps that teachers can refer to when designing deep learning teaching.It aims to provide operational guidance and reference for teachers,stimulate students’ active and positive learning,develop their potential for deep learning,promote their ability to process and transfer knowledge,and cultivate their higher-order thinking skills,providing new perspectives and methods for education.
